The Evolution of Golf Simulation: From Basic Graphics to Data-Driven Precision
Historically, golf simulators began as simple visual representations, limited to basic graphics and rudimentary swing analysis. As the industry matured, the integration of high-speed cameras, advanced sensors, and real-time computational processing elevated these systems into complex tools capable of delivering precise data on swing mechanics, ball trajectory, and environmental factors.
Today’s leading simulators incorporate technologies such as laser measurement, 3D motion capture, and AI-powered analytics. These innovations enable players to scrutinize every nuance of their swing with sub-millimeter accuracy, similar to how professional athletes analyze performance with motion-tracking systems. Industry reports suggest that the global golf simulator market is projected to grow at a compound annual growth rate (CAGR) of approximately 7.4% through 2027, driven largely by technological advancements and increased engagement from both amateurs and professionals.
Industry Insights and Data Trends
| Metric | 2023 Estimate | Projected 2027 | Growth |
|---|---|---|---|
| Market Value (USD) | $1.1 billion | $1.8 billion | 63.6% |
| Number of Units Sold | Approx. 55,000 | Approx. 90,000 | 64% |
| User Engagement (hours/year) | 15 hours | 22 hours | 46.7% |
This data underscores not only technological progression but also an increasing integration of simulation tools into the routine of clubs, retail outlets, and private homes worldwide. The adoption of high-fidelity simulators aligns with broader industry shifts towards personalized training programs, digital analytics, and virtual competitions.

Technological Breakthroughs That Define the Future
- AI and Machine Learning: Personalizing training by adapting swing models based on real-time feedback.
- Augmented Reality (AR): Bringing simulators into immersive environments for enhanced visual cues.
- Sensor Miniaturization: Pocket-sized sensors providing detailed biomechanical data without hindering natural movement.
- Cloud Data Integration: Facilitating remote coaching, performance benchmarking, and social competition.
